Innovative Materials in Fashion
The fashion industry is constantly evolving, with innovative materials leading the way in shaping future trends. As manufacturers seek to differentiate their products in a competitive market, these materials offer exciting opportunities.
Biodegradable Fabrics
Biodegradable fabrics are gaining traction as sustainability becomes a priority for consumers and businesses alike. Manufacturers are exploring options that minimize environmental impact while maintaining quality and aesthetics.
Smart Textiles
Smart textiles equipped with technology that can monitor health or adapt to environmental conditions are redefining functional fashion. These fabrics are appealing to tech-savvy consumers and are paving the way for innovative product designs.
Recycled Materials
The use of recycled materials in fashion manufacturing is on the rise, driven by a growing demand for sustainable practices. By incorporating recycled fabrics, manufacturers can reduce waste and cater to eco-conscious consumers.
Performance Fabrics
Performance fabrics designed for specific uses, such as activewear or outdoor gear, are increasingly popular. Manufacturers who invest in these technologies can attract niche markets and provide exceptional products.
Conclusion
In summary, innovative materials are revolutionizing fashion manufacturing. By embracing these advancements, manufacturers can lead the charge toward a more sustainable and exciting future in fashion.
